Mt. Bachelor Sunrise Area Improvements
An expansion of the "Snow Play Zone" was approved in the 2013 EIS however, their recent proposal includes changes that require removing additional trees and installing a 3-tower chairlift and power conduits instead of a "magic carpet" surface lift.

Location Summary:
This project proposal is located northeast of the Sunrise Lodge in the Mt. Bachelor ski area, between the lodge and Cascades Lakes Highway. Mt. Bachelor is located about 8 miles southwest of Bend, OR.
